Unsure (Adjective)

Meaning 1

Lacking self-confidence; "stood in the doorway diffident and abashed"; "problems that call for bold not timid responses"; "a very unsure young man".

Examples

  • She stood in front of the class, an unsure expression on her face as she tried to recall the answer to the teacher's question.
  • He was an unsure public speaker, stumbling over his words and avoiding eye contact with the audience.
  • The young artist was unsure of her abilities, and her paintings reflected her lack of confidence.
  • As she walked into the crowded room, she felt unsure of herself, clinging to her friend's arm for support.
  • After the accident, he was unsure if he could ever get back on a bike again, his fear and doubt holding him back.

Synonyms

  • Timid
  • Diffident
  • Shy

Meaning 2

Lacking or indicating lack of confidence or assurance; "uncertain of his convictions"; "unsure of himself and his future"; "moving with uncertain (or unsure) steps"; "an uncertain smile"; "touched the ornaments with uncertain fingers".

Synonyms

  • Uncertain
  • Incertain

Antonyms

  • Sure
